History Politics Geography

HISTORY POLITICS GEOGRAPHY Some guy once said there's lies, damn lies, and statistics But he surely meant lies, damn lies, and politics; And since all the people are dead in history Why to study it remains a mystery. Where the greatest truth and topography Is found is in studying the field of geography : Full of tectonics where Atlantic’s separating plates both Move as fast as your fingernails’ growth; Full of atmospherics with winds turned by coriolis And electric shimmers called aurora borealis; Full of maps showing countries’ boundaries and capitals Such as tropical Nicaragua’s or Himalayan Nepal’s; Full of guys like Walter Christaller who study locations of cities And can tell Chicagoans why their city is where it is; Full of cool pictures from NASA or Hubble Showing whether there’s going to be weather trouble; Full of V-shaped valleys riverine, U-shaped valleys glacial And C-shaped barchan dunes, all neatly alphabetical. When your solo study with textbook is proving to be boring Your grades get higher and easier and you’ll enjoy the scoring If you start to do a bit of fieldwork in any part of your world, Because geography is all around you, ready unfurled: So much interesting knowledge : all I could ever have wished: Spent a lifetime studying it and still nowhere near finished. .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. Written by Sydney Peck for Dana'lynn Smith's Contest Politically Educated
